What Are Freestyle Type Beats?

To figure out the importance of freestyle trap beats, it's vital to initially break down what a freestyle beat really is. In straightforward terms, a freestyle beat is an crucial track that is created for artists to rap or sing over without the demand for pre-written lyrics or tunes. It's meant to influence off-the-cuff performances, motivating rappers to supply spontaneous and typically much more raw, impulsive verses.

A freestyle type beat varies a little from a regular instrumental because it's structured in such a way that offers musicians space to breathe. These beats often have less ariose aspects, leaving space for complex flows and powerful wordplay. They're likewise commonly a lot more repetitive than standard track instrumentals, ensuring that the rap artist or singer can easily locate their groove and ride the beat without obtaining lost in complex plans.

Freestyle Trap Beats A Subgenre Within Freestyle

Currently, within the territory of freestyle beats, there is a particular part referred to as freestyle trap beat. Trap songs, originating from the southerly USA, is defined by intense use of 808 bass drums, fast hi-hat patterns, and dark, moody melodies. It's a sound that has actually grown in popularity over the years, becoming one of one of the most significant categories in contemporary rap.

Freestyle trap beats take these signature elements and fuse them with the flexibility and flexibility of freestyle beats, causing a impressive combination. These beats are ideal for musicians looking to bring power and aggressiveness to their verses while still keeping the liberty to check out different flows and styles.

DaBaby Type Beat: A Modern Freestyle Picture

Among the many variations of freestyle trap beats, the DaBaby type beat has actually become one of one of the most in-demand. DaBaby type beats are influenced by the trademark sound of the North Carolina rap artist DaBaby, recognized for his rapid-fire distribution, catchy hooks, and compelling production. These beats typically include fast paces, punchy 808s, and minimalistic yet hostile melodies, making them excellent for high-energy freestyle performances.

Why DaBaby Type Beats Work So perfect for Freestyles

1. Fast Paces: The quick pace of a DaBaby type beat encourages rappers to provide speedy flows, compeling them to think on their feet and press their lyrical limits.
2. Straightforward Yet Appealing Tunes: Unlike some trap beats that can be overly complicated, DaBaby type beats are typically developed around straightforward, recurring melodies that leave area for the rapper's vocals to beam.
3. Compelling Drums: The hostile percussion in these beats adds an element of seriousness, driving the musician to match the beat's strength with their verses.

What Is a Free Type Beat?

A free type beat is an instrumental that producers offer absolutely free use, normally for non-commercial purposes. While the beats can be used for demonstrations, freestyles, and social media web content, artists typically need to pay for a certificate if they wish to launch the track commercially (i.e., on streaming platforms or for sale).

This design has been a game-changer, allowing young artists to trying out their sound, exercise their freestyling, and build an online existence without having to fret about production expenses.
